Amy started dancing at 3 years old at The Jo Cook School of Dance, where she gained solid dance foundations from RAD Ballet, ISTD Modern, and ISTD Tap. At 15 she began to take open jazz classes with Diane Curtis and went on to train professionally at London Studio Centre at 16 years old. There she expanded her training to include Matt Mattox jazz, Graham Contemporary, Street Jazz, voice and drama. After graduating at 19, Amy continued her training at Pineapple Dance Studios, and found her groove thanks to the legendary Jimmy Williams and his incredible Locking & Jazz Funk styles.
​
As a performer, Amy's love has always been for the stage and live performance. She combined all her experience when becoming a dancer, Dance Captain and ultimately Resident Director of the international touring show ‘Bounce - The Street Dance Sensation’. Amy then joined ZooNation becoming a creative cast member in the original production of ‘Into The Hoods’.
